Odoo as the Foundation for Operational Intelligence
Odoo provides a unified environment where retail operations are managed through interconnected modules. Key modules include Inventory for stock management, Purchase for procurement, Sales for order management, and Accounting for financial tracking. This integration ensures that data flows seamlessly across functions, reducing silos and improving visibility.
The platform's flexibility allows for customization through Odoo Studio and API integrations, enabling enterprises to tailor workflows to their specific needs. However, the deterministic nature of Odoo ensures that core business processes remain reliable and auditable, providing a stable foundation for AI enhancements.
AI-Enhanced Cross-Functional Visibility
AI complements Odoo by adding layers of intelligence to existing workflows. For instance, AI can analyze historical sales data to forecast demand, identify anomalies in inventory levels, and predict potential supply chain disruptions. These insights are presented through natural language interfaces, allowing non-technical users to query operational data easily.
Intelligent document processing can automate the extraction of data from supplier invoices, purchase orders, and shipping documents, reducing manual entry errors. AI-assisted routing can prioritize tasks based on urgency and impact, ensuring that critical issues are addressed promptly.
Architecture for AI-Integrated Odoo Systems
| Component | Role | Technology |
|---|---|---|
| System of Record | Stores operational data | Odoo ERP |
| Orchestration Layer | Manages workflow execution | n8n or similar |
| AI Reasoning Layer | Provides insights and predictions | Qwen or LLM |
| Data Infrastructure | Supports AI processing | PostgreSQL, Vector DB |
This architecture ensures that AI operates as a complementary layer, enhancing Odoo's capabilities without replacing its deterministic processes. APIs and webhooks facilitate data exchange between Odoo and AI components, while workflow engines orchestrate the execution of AI-assisted tasks.

Data Quality and Governance
Effective AI integration requires high-quality data. Odoo's master data, including product, customer, and supplier information, must be accurate and consistent. Data validation processes ensure that AI models receive reliable inputs, reducing the risk of erroneous insights.
Governance measures include prompt controls, model access restrictions, and human approval for high-impact decisions. Auditability and logging ensure that AI actions are traceable, supporting compliance and accountability.
Security and Access Control
Security is paramount in AI-integrated systems. Odoo's user permissions and access control mechanisms ensure that only authorized users can interact with AI features. API credentials and secrets are managed securely, preventing unauthorized access to sensitive data.
Data isolation and least privilege principles protect against data breaches, while monitoring and observability tools detect and respond to security incidents promptly.

Reliability and Monitoring
Reliability is achieved through validation, structured outputs, retries, and error handling. Monitoring and observability tools track AI performance, detecting issues early and enabling rapid response.
Fallback workflows ensure that operations continue smoothly if AI components fail, maintaining business continuity.
